My favorite performance: Nov. 30, 1974: LSU vs. Utah, temperature at kickoff 38 degrees and dropping toward freezing. At that time the band had no cold weather gear and all the GGs had was a cape. They shivered through the first half (though many sought the comfort of the first aid station on the west side). Taking the field for the half-time show, they piled their capes into my arms behind the goalpost. Then they put on their game faces and danced and smiled through the ten minute half-time show. When they marched off the field their demeanor quickly changed, and they descended on me for those capes like a pack of hyenas on the fresh carcass of a wildebeest.
